Maison >base de données >Oracle >Instruction pour la valeur de retour de la fonction dans Oracle

Instruction pour la valeur de retour de la fonction dans Oracle

下次还敢
下次还敢original
2024-05-09 21:42:14770parcourir

Dans Oracle, utilisez l'instruction RETURN pour spécifier la valeur de retour de la fonction. Cette instruction est située à la fin du corps de la fonction et est utilisée pour renvoyer le résultat du calcul de la fonction. La syntaxe de l'instruction RETURN est la suivante : RETURN expression_valeur ; où expression_valeur est une expression qui calcule et renvoie la valeur de la fonction.

Instruction pour la valeur de retour de la fonction dans Oracle

Déclaration pour la valeur de retour de la fonction dans Oracle

Dans Oracle, utilisez l'instruction RETURN pour spécifier la valeur de retour d'une fonction. Il est situé à la fin du corps de la fonction et est utilisé pour spécifier le résultat du calcul de la fonction.

Syntaxe :

<code>RETURN value_expression;</code>

Où :

  • value_expression est une expression qui calcule et renvoie la valeur d'une fonction.

Exemple :

Considérons une fonction qui calcule la somme de deux nombres :

<code class="sql">CREATE FUNCTION add_numbers(
  x NUMBER,
  y NUMBER
) RETURN NUMBER
IS
BEGIN
  RETURN x + y;
END;</code>

Dans cette fonction, l'instruction RETURN renvoie la valeur de l'expression x + y, représentant la somme des deux nombres saisis.

Remarque : l'instruction

  • RETURN ne peut apparaître qu'à la fin du corps de la fonction.
  • Les fonctions doivent avoir un type de valeur de retour, qui est spécifié par l'instruction RETURN.
  • Différents types de fonctions peuvent avoir différents types de valeurs de retour.
  • Lorsqu'une fonction a plusieurs valeurs de retour, vous pouvez utiliser le paramètre OUT ou le type d'enregistrement.

Ce qui précède est le contenu détaillé de. pour plus d'informations, suivez d'autres articles connexes sur le site Web de PHP en chinois!

Déclaration:
Le contenu de cet article est volontairement contribué par les internautes et les droits d'auteur appartiennent à l'auteur original. Ce site n'assume aucune responsabilité légale correspondante. Si vous trouvez un contenu suspecté de plagiat ou de contrefaçon, veuillez contacter admin@php.cn